Yes, I know it is a bit hard to align camera, model, horizon and viewing angel in those outdoor pictures. I fiddle also every time with these parameters and try to check photos of the original before. My setup with two tripods is more adjustable, but sometimes I need even to adjust the angle of the base to get a good picture with a realistic horizon in background.
You are absolute right - the safety of the model has priority! Once, on a sunny but windy day in November, a gust was so strong that the heavy model lifted one leg of the landing gear off the base - I feared a moment of shock - it flies off and I lose it!
